Subdivision Paving in Little Rock, AR
Subdivision paving services involve the installation and improvement of paved surfaces within residential developments, neighborhoods, or community subdivisions. This service typically covers projects such as new street construction, driveway paving, parking lot creation, and paving of private roads or pathways within a subdivision. Property owners considering subdivision paving should understand the scope of work involved, including site preparation, grading, and surface finishing, to ensure the paved area meets the needs of traffic flow, accessibility, and durability.
Before requesting subdivision paving, property owners usually want to know about the materials used, the expected lifespan of the pavement, and any necessary permits or approvals. It’s also helpful to consider the drainage plan, as proper water runoff management is essential for long-term pavement integrity. Clarifying these details can support informed decisions and help ensure the paving project aligns with the overall development plans and property requirements.

Subdivision Paving Questions
What is subdivision paving? Subdivision paving involves installing or resurfacing roads, driveways, and parking areas within residential or commercial subdivisions to ensure smooth and durable surfaces.
What types of projects are common for subdivision paving? Common projects include new street construction, road repairs, parking lot paving, and driveway installations within residential developments.
Why is proper paving important in subdivisions? Proper paving provides a safe, functional surface that supports traffic flow and helps prevent damage caused by weather and heavy use.
What should property owners consider before paving? Consider the existing surface condition, drainage needs, and the type of paving material suitable for the area to ensure longevity and performance.
